On Tue, Jun 15, 2021 at 06:48:10PM +0800, Xie Yongji wrote:
> This ensures that we will not use an invalid block size
> in config space (might come from an untrusted device).
> 
> Signed-off-by: Xie Yongji <xieyongji@bytedance.com>

I'd say if device presents an unreasonable value,
and we want to ignore that, then we should not
negotiate VIRTIO_BLK_F_BLK_SIZE so that host knows.

So maybe move the logic to validate_features.

> ---
>  drivers/block/virtio_blk.c | 2 +-
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/block/virtio_blk.c b/drivers/block/virtio_blk.c
> index b9fa3ef5b57c..85ae3b27ea4b 100644
> --- a/drivers/block/virtio_blk.c
> +++ b/drivers/block/virtio_blk.c
> @@ -827,7 +827,7 @@ static int virtblk_probe(struct virtio_device *vdev)
>  	err = virtio_cread_feature(vdev, VIRTIO_BLK_F_BLK_SIZE,
>  				   struct virtio_blk_config, blk_size,
>  				   &blk_size);
> -	if (!err)
> +	if (!err && blk_size >= SECTOR_SIZE && blk_size <= PAGE_SIZE)
>  		blk_queue_logical_block_size(q, blk_size);
>  	else
>  		blk_size = queue_logical_block_size(q);
